Abstract

A shaving apparatus comprising a first shaving unit, including a first outer cutter () and a first undercutter () which cooperate together, a skin agitation member (), a housing and a drive source () mounted in the housing. The outer cutter is mounted in a frame (). The drive source is coupled to the first undercutter to provide oscillatory movement with respect to the frame at a frequency in the range 70 to 280 Hz. The drive source is also coupled to the skin agitation member to provide oscillatory movement at a frequency in the range 5 to 50 Hz. The first outer cutter is un-driven with respect to the frame.
